Is it in Beaverton or Tualitin Hills? Is it a “novice” park or what? Who cares? The new Grindline built concrete addition to the skatepark at the Howard M. Terpenning Recreation Complex is indeed open for skating.

It’s pretty close to the original design. It looks like some rails were added and one of the existing rails was turned into a pole jam. Add some small transition to the back of the hubba and a little bit of pool coping in parts of the bowl and you’re ready. There was some heated discussion on the merits of building such a facility. Now that all the dust has settled, what’s the end result? This little park is small but fun. Very small in terms of square footage and depth, but packed full of opportunity for novice and the more skilled alike.

Where exactly is it? Follow this link. The park has lights on until 10pm. Has this been verified? Well, the rest of the park has the same lights, and they used to be kept on at night as well, although it’s been a good five or six years since I’ve been there at night. Here’s a crappy shot of 180 nose grind on a fat rail. The ones with better exposures were mid-bail.
New Beaverton/Tualatin Hills skatepark addition

Lots of little places to hit tucked in everywhere. Check out the gap there. It would have been fine left alone, but it’s also got a nice little (tight) transition in there too. You can ignore it or explore it.
